Verse (91:9), Word 2 - Quranic Grammar

__

The second word of verse (91:9) is a form IV perfect verb (فعل ماض). The verb is third person masculine singular. The verb's triliteral root is fā lām ḥā (ف ل ح).

Chapter (91) sūrat l-shams (The Sun)


(91:9:2)
aflaḥa
he succeeds
V – 3rd person masculine singular (form IV) perfect verb فعل ماض

Verse (91:9)

The analysis above refers to the ninth verse of chapter 91 (sūrat l-shams):

Sahih International: He has succeeded who purifies it,
